Transaction 14f6346cee6e80ec72c3934a80a55d4108e21e40e02c07ed60c9b4ec8ad97818
1 Input
1 Output
-
14f6346cee6e80ec72c3934a80a55d4108e21e40e02c07ed60c9b4ec8ad97818:0
- value
- 6777004
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68939d00c0a7ebe43016b919f95185e581241847 OP_EQUAL
- address
- 3BDy2qzXLRwNuRgKeAUfbYPca6GEcX42to